Galaxy A6 has a score of 75.8, which is much better than the Galaxy S II T-Mobile's general score of 65.3. Galaxy A6 is a incredibly newer and thinner cellphone than Galaxy S II T-Mobile, although it is somewhat heavier. Samsung Galaxy S II T-Mobile has a little more vivid display than Galaxy A6, although it has much less pixels per inch of display, a bit smaller screen and a lot worse 800 x 480px resolution.
Samsung Galaxy A6 counts with a bit superior CPU than Galaxy S II T-Mobile, because although it has doesn't have an additional GPU, it also counts with a larger number of cores (and also faster) and more RAM. The Galaxy A6 features a very superior storage to install applications and games than Galaxy S II T-Mobile, because it has a SD memory card expansion slot that holds up to 400 GB and 16 GB more internal storage.
The Samsung Galaxy A6 captures better videos and photos than Samsung Galaxy S II T-Mobile, and although they both have the same 1920x1080 video resolution and the same 30 fps video frame rate, the Samsung Galaxy A6 also has a way larger diafragm aperture, a larger back camera sensor and a back camera with way more megapixels.
The Galaxy A6 features a way better battery life than Galaxy S II T-Mobile, because it has a 3000mAh battery capacity.
Even being the best phone in this comparison, Samsung Galaxy A6 is also cheaper than the Samsung Galaxy S II T-Mobile, making this phone a simple decision.
